What concepts can I expect to review when I study with the Oklahoma City science tutors near me?
The specific concepts that you can cover during private Oklahoma City science tutoring will depend on your individual skills and requirements. In most classroom environments, the teacher has a set syllabus that they have to complete within a specific amount of time while attempting to juggle the needs of an entire classroom of students with different learning requirements. This can leave students falling through the cracks as their questions and concerns go unaddressed. The teacher also can't adjust their teaching methods to benefit various different learning types, which can cause students to struggle with new information during class.
One-on-one instruction is designed to cater to your individual needs. A private science tutor can help you focus on the issues that you find the most difficult, whether you're working through the application of forces or matter and energy concepts. They can try out a variety of different teaching approaches as well, which can help you engage with the information more deeply. Your instructor can identify the techniques that are most supportive of your learning tendencies, as well as provide customized activities that give you the chance to apply those skills to different situations. For instance, if you are a visual student who is struggling to get the hang of electricity topics, your mentor can use visual aids to demonstrate the process behind using light bulbs to light up a room. Alternatively, a tactile student might benefit more from working through a hands-on project while their instructor monitors their progress.
Whether you're studying with Oklahoma City science tutors after school or during the summer, your instructor can focus on the concepts that you find the most challenging. If you're in school, they can incorporate your class curriculum to review concepts you didn't fully understand during your time in class. They can assist you with homework, as well as help you prepare for tests and exams as they approach. Your instructor can even spend time going over testing and study techniques that can help you work more effectively, regardless of what you are focused on.
